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
032 8320 65358761538 75 76237702780
73 02342435 24702
73 02342435 24702
66 20037622 314 97 5857
All about undefined
Interested in learning more?
73 02342435 24702
66 20037622 314 97 5857
See more
10568463 6780573
164 37 17 381706
See more
741 5939624415
9442 86 965941923 99
See more